A new opportunity with a dynamic and progressive law firm for a Clinical Negligence Solicitor has become available in Huddersfield. This Legal 500, award winning law firm is one of the top 50 fastest-growing companies in Yorkshire.  

If career progression is important to you, this is an opportunity not to be missed, this firm is passionate about career progression and job fulfilment. 

The role will involve working closely with a Senior Associate and Director, assisting them on complex and high value clinical negligence claims, while also maintaining a caseload of approximately 40 cases of lower complexity and value, across all types of clinical negligence work.

Applications are welcomed from qualified solicitors, trainee solicitors, legal executives, or paralegals with experience of running their own files. They will also consider those with experience of either Claimant work or Defendant work.

On their own cases, the successful candidate would be expected to undertake all aspects of a clinical negligence claim, from initial case planning through investigation and obtaining evidence, the pre-action protocol, issuing and serving of proceedings, and litigation all the way to trial where necessary. You would of course be closely supervised, supported, and trained by more experienced colleagues.
